Apple Recruitment are recruiting for an Adult Learning Disability Personal Secretary (Band 3)
Job Purpose:
* Provide a full secretarial support service to the team and other professionals.
* Maintain diaries; arrange diary dates, venues, travel arrangement and hospitality. This also includes minute taking, audio typing and shorthand/note taking.
* Organise the office and carry out routine secretarial duties which include the development and maintenance of an efficient filing system, brought forward system, mail distribution, photo copying, binding and ensure relevant files are available for meetings.
* Responsible for recording and maintaining reports relevant to the department e.g. salaries & wages, annual leave, sick leave, maternity leave, carers leave and special leave.
* Contribute to the collection and collation of statistical information on a regular basis.
* Update/search information on client database (Paris/Socare) as required.
* Open and record incoming mail and direct correspondence for the Team or otherwise deal with routine items. This will include the writing and drafting of routine letters for signature.

Essential Criteria:
Applicants must, by the closing date for applications, have:
1. 3 years administrative/clerical experience
2. a) 5 GCSE’s (Grades A-C) to include English Language and Maths or equivalent qualification or higher educational standard AND one year’s administrative/clerical experience;
OR
b) NVQ Level 2 in Business Administration or equivalent or higher educational standard AND one year’s administrative/clerical experience.
1. In addition to one of the above, 6 months experience using Microsoft Office including Outlook, Powerpoint, Excel and Word is also essential.
1. Hold a current full driving licence which is valid for use in the UK and have access to a car on appointment.
